YOUTH DEVELOPMENT UNIT (UNINJO)
The Youth Development Unit is a division within the Instituto Dominicano de Desarrollo Integral, (IDDI). Staring it’s functions in 1992, it’s dedicated to promote, develop and provide young people living in vulnerable sectors of the Dominican Republic, with an area for personal growth by promoting healthy lifestyles, fostering social skills and social participation in their communities.

Services
Prevention Programs
Information, Education and Communication (IEC) regarding reproductive health, HIV / AIDS and healthy lifestyles.
Vocational technical training
Technical courses to train youth in a productive vocation.
Job placement and credit management
Insert the young into the workforce after completion of technical courses
Referrals for comprehensive health care and emotional support
Installation of a reference and counter reference (two-way information)
Training in skills to mediate in conflicts
Social participation and leadership
Training in environmental conservation
Training of facilitators and multipliers

Legislation
The Unidad Integral de Jovenes, (UNINJO). Is legal under the Youth Act (Act 49-2000), enacted on July 1st, 2000 which aims to establish the legal, policy and institutional framework to guide the actions of state and society in general, towards the definition and implementation, of all policies necessary to achieve the satisfaction of the needs and expectations of young people of the Nation, as well as effective youth participation in the decision-making processes.
The purpose of the Act is to promote the integral development of young people, regardless of gender, religion, political, racial, ethnic or sexual orientation and/or nationality.
This law further provides, that it should contribute to the integration of youth into national life in the political, economic, social, and cultural, as well as, ensure the realization of human rights, civil, political, economic and social conditions that allow young people to fully participate in the development of the nation.
